The Company is in search of a Head of Digital Systems and Process Transformation to lead the strategic evolution of operational excellence and data-driven decision-making. This pivotal role involves guiding a talented team in the design and enhancement of backend systems, ensuring efficiency and scalability across all departments. The successful candidate will be responsible for mentoring team members, staying abreast of technological advancements, and fostering a culture of continuous improvement. Key responsibilities include conducting in-depth analyses of existing business processes, developing innovative workflows, and overseeing the complete software development lifecycle to deliver high-quality, user-friendly system solutions that align with business objectives.
Applicants for the Head of Digital Systems and Process Transformation position at the company should have a minimum of 7 years' experience in business process management, business systems development, or process reengineering within complex organizations. A Bachelor's degree in IT, computer science, business administration, or a related discipline is required, along with a comprehensive background in finance, accounting, sales, and related systems. The role demands hands-on expertise in programming, particularly in C#, .Net, and Azure, and a proven track record in system architecture design. The ideal candidate will have experience engineering teams, exceptional communication skills, and the ability to bridge technical implementation with business needs. A preference is given to those with a strong business process background and a process-oriented approach to problem-solving.
